Xbox One May update detailed. Rolling out now to preview members

May is coming and it’s nearly time for the whole Xbox community to take in new features on their Xbox One. But as is always the case, preview members get first crack at the action…but what will be on the menu?

Well, Xbox One owners will find a variety of new features, although most of them are firmly planted in the Smartglass camp. The full list is below, but we’re super excited to finally see the option to switch our consoles on and off via our phones and tablets. Whilst not completely necessary for Kinect users, it’ll surely be a great help to those running a Kinect-free system.

As always, MajorNelson has all the details, plus a handy little vid right below that shows the next lot of features – and those coming to the Xbox App for Windows 10!

  • Over-the-air TV for the U.S. and Canada – Earlier this month, we announced the preview for an Over-the-Air Tuner for the U.S. and Canada.
  • Power on and off from Xbox One SmartGlass – The beta versions of the Xbox One SmartGlass apps for Windows, Windows Phone and Android will be updated to let you turn your Xbox One on and off.
  • Wireless Display app – Try the Wireless Display app to cast photos stored on your phone to your Xbox One, or to stream non-protected video content from your PC to your Xbox.
  • User-selectable power mode – Select your preferred power mode, either Instant-on or Energy-saving mode.
  • Voice messages – The ability to send and receive voice messages from the Xbox One messages app continues in preview this month.
